Output 3d2a84c15063b0de05bf46db1e94abd1d6925e17e6fd180f6ea1024feccb3aa3:5

value
625113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005b87429314444ffead0f723c885a7669cca3c6 OP_EQUAL
address
31iua3bt4U5Yk9ovaqn7ayPuFNj43tv7y2
transaction
3d2a84c15063b0de05bf46db1e94abd1d6925e17e6fd180f6ea1024feccb3aa3
spent
true